Kitchen remodeling costs change based on the scope of your vision. Opting for custom cabinetry, high-end stone countertops, or moving plumbing and gas lines will shift your budget upward. Conversely, keeping your existing layout and choosing stock materials can help keep expenses manageable. We help you navigate these choices so you get the best value for your specific space. Granite countertops are a popular choice for kitchens in Asheville due to their natural beauty and durability. Each slab is unique, offering a distinct look that can really make your kitchen pop. Granite is heat and scratch-resistant, making it practical for everyday use. On the downside, it's porous and requires sealing to prevent stains, and it can be quite heavy, impacting installation costs. Let's talk about what makes sense for your remodel.

Painting existing kitchen cupboards can be a cost-effective way to update your kitchen's look in Asheville. It's a great option if your cabinets are structurally sound but just need a color refresh. The key to a good result is proper preparation, including cleaning, sanding, and priming. You'll want to use high-quality paint designed for cabinets to ensure durability. White kitchen units remain a timeless choice, and in Asheville, the trend leans towards clean, minimalist styles. Think Shaker-style doors or flat-panel designs for a modern feel. Matte finishes are gaining popularity over high gloss for a softer look. Accents like brushed nickel or matte black hardware can add a sophisticated touch. Ready-to-assemble (RTA) kitchen cabinets can be a budget-friendly option for homeowners in Asheville looking for a DIY approach. They come flat-packed and require assembly before installation. While they can save money on labor, ensure you have the time and tools for proper assembly. The quality can vary, so it's important to research brands carefully.
